Thousands of people gathered on the grounds of Vels University in Chennai, India to celebrate Puthandu – the Tamil New Year – in record-breaking style. N. Athistabalan spent a year organising a Guinness World Records title attempt at the Largest Bharatha Natyam dance, and his efforts certainly paid off as a record 4,525 participants turned […]

BTOS Productions and AR Rahman have announced the date of a new AR Rahman concert in London and from the name it has been given, this could be the first ever Tamil concert by AR Rahman in Europe. Titled “Netru Indru Nalai”, the highly anticipated concert will take place at the SSE Arena in Wembley, […]
